Jhang LG polls: Political activities gain momentum
From Our Correspondent
JHANG: Political activities have started gaining momentum for the local government elections scheduled to be held in the district on December 5.
Most of the candidates have launched their election campaign while some senior workers of the PML-N allege that the party parliamentarians have ignored them in distribution of tickets and now they will contest the elections as independent candidates. They allege that when it comes to the distribution of party tickets, the party parliamentarians ignore the honest and committed workers and give tickets to the turncoats. Meanwhile, PML-N MPA Rashida Yaqoob Sheikh and MNA Sheikh Akram have developed differences with each other over distribution of party tickets. When contacted, PML-N district president Khalid Ghani said that the PML-N provincial leadership has called the MNA and the MPA to resolve the issue. He said that all issues regarding the party tickets will soon be resolved.
